Hey, all. Today I found some grey gunk, sort of the consistency of earwax, in Raja's ears. I got it  out easily with a dry Q-tip (didn't stick it in his ears, don't worry, just cleaned the bits I could get with his ear inside out). He did get in the way while I was pouring litter into his litterbox today, so at first I thought maybe some of that got in somehow, but doesn't look like it. Just not sure if this is something I should be worried about...nervous first-time cat mom here (parents were in charge of the other cats in my life).

Gunky ears can be a sign of mites.  Is it like a blackish dirt and gummy?  Does he scratch it?  Regardless a vet visit, not an emergency but a regular visit is probably in order.

If you know how to safely clean his ears and are able to clean them well and the gunk does not return then its unlikely to be mites, but if they get dirty again then it is likely.
